Description
Nestled in the prestigious West Goshen area of Chester County, 1044 Warren Rd is a stunning two-story Colonial home exuding timeless elegance and modern charm. Painted in serene natural colors, the home welcomes you with a sophisticated slate foyer. The expansive living room boasts rich hardwood flooring, complemented by elegant chair rail and crown molding, seamlessly flowing into the formal dining area. The kitchen features modern white cabinetry, sleek new hardware, and under-mount lighting that highlights the exquisite granite countertops and decorative tile backsplash. Coordinating stainless steel appliances enhance the kitchen’s contemporary appeal, while the abundant counter space is ideal for entertaining and small appliances. A charming eat-in breakfast area, complete with a modern light fixture and sliding doors, leads you out to the inviting back deck. A separate family room, straight out of a magazine, offers built-in bookshelves flanking another wood-burning fireplace. Sunlight floods this room, accentuating the warm and rich tones of the hardwood flooring. The first floor is completed by a convenient powder room and a separate main floor laundry, ensuring everyday ease. Upstairs, the second floor offers four spacious bedrooms and two full baths. The owner’s bedroom is a private retreat, featuring a full bath and a generous walk-in closet. Three additional bedrooms are generously sized and share a centrally located full bathroom. The semi-finished basement provides versatile additional living space, perfect for a playroom or whatever suits your needs. An extensive storage area with built-in shelving adds to the home’s functionality. Outside, the property offers abundant yard space, including a large front yard, a private backyard, ensuring privacy and endless possibilities for outdoor activities. The large back deck holds separate enjoyment spaces with a pergola on one side & open section for sunlight on the other side. The deck leads to built in above ground pool with a separate section holding an outdoor firepit for year round use. The playhouse situated on hillside, is ideal for creative imagination complete with a loft, two beds and more.
